摘要
The debate over the optimal contrast administration method involves many issues. This article discusses bolus versus infusion administration pertaining to myocardial perfusion imaging. Continuous infusion ensures efficient and optimal data capture during contrast studies and is preferred over bolus injection for both theoretical and practical reasons. Although bolus administration is easier, its relative disadvantages outweigh its usefulness in myocardial perfusion imaging. (C) 2002 by Excerpta Medica, Inc.
